How the XRP Ledger Works
XRP Ledger Basics
The XRP Ledger (XRPL) is a decentralized public blockchain designed for enterprise use. Its open peer-to-peer network is maintained by a global community of software engineers, businesses, and individuals collaborating to drive real-world innovation.
Key Features:
- Decentralized governance: Operated by a diverse group of validators worldwide.
- Enterprise-grade reliability: Over 10 years of error-free operation.
- Energy efficiency: Negligible energy consumption compared to proof-of-work blockchains.
Consensus Protocol: The Engine of XRPL
Understanding XRPL's Consensus Mechanism
XRPL employs a unique consensus protocol where designated servers (validators) agree on transaction outcomes every 3-5 seconds. This system ensures:
- Instant confirmation: Transactions complying with protocol rules are confirmed immediately.
- Transparency: All transactions are publicly verifiable with cryptographic integrity.
- Decentralization: 120+ active validators operated by universities, exchanges, and individuals.

Frequently Asked Questions
Is XRPL a private blockchain owned by Ripple?
No. XRPL is fully decentralized. Network changes require 80% validator approval. Ripple operates just 1 of 150+ validators.
How does XRPL's consensus compare to Proof of Work?
XRPL's consensus is:
- Faster (3-5 second confirmations vs. 10+ minutes)
- Cheaper (fractional energy costs)
- More sustainable (carbon neutral since 2020)
